Australian Organic Limited members are invited to join an online member briefing on the proposed changes to AOL’s Constitution ahead of the Special General Meeting on Friday 25 September.
Wednesday 16 September | 4:30pm AEST | Online via Zoom
The AOL Board has undertaken a review of the Constitution to modernise our governance arrangements, respond to feedback received from members and ensure our governance framework better supports the organisation into the future.
This webinar is an opportunity to hear directly from AOL about:
- why the Constitution has been reviewed;
- the key changes being proposed;
- what the changes would mean for members in practice;
- proposed changes to membership categories and voting rights;
- how Directors and the Chair would be appointed and elected;
- other governance and operational changes included in the proposed Constitution;
- what happens at the SGM and how members can participate and vote.
Importantly, there will be plenty of time for member questions.
We encourage members to read the proposed Constitution and accompanying explanatory material circulated with the SGM Notice before attending and bring along any questions.
